How to Use Fiberglass or Silk for Nail Repairs

  1. Prepare the nail as you normally would for a gel-polish service.
  2. Size the silk or fiberglass to the nail. Here I am using Backscratchers precut self-adhesive fiberglass.
  3. Apply the strip to the nail.
  4. Cut off the excess fiberglass or silk at the free edge of the nail.

How to apply a fiberglass nail strip?

3. Apply the strip to the nail. 4. Cut off the excess fiberglass or silk at the free edge of the nail. 5. Apply a thin layer of base coat to just the fiberglass by pressing it into the fiberglass. Do not brush it on. Cure. 6. Brush on a thin layer of base coat over the entire nail and cure.

How to fix a broken nail with a coffee filter?

Coffee filter material also works! Put a thin layer of nail glue or super glue across the broken part of your nail. Using tweezers, lay the tea bag material down flat on your nail and fold part of it under your nail tip. Put another layer of glue over the tea bag material.

What happens when you break your finger?

A broken fingernail happens when part of your nail gets torn, chipped, split, smashed, or broken off. This can result from your nail getting caught on something or being involved in some kind of finger trauma. Serious breaks can also injure the nail bed and nail matrix, where the cells that make up the nail are produced.

Why do my nails break?

Here are some common causes of nail breaks: constant exposure to moisture, which can soften and weaken the nail. nail weakness or brittleness from age or malnutrition. injury or weakness from fake nail glue. habitual biting or picking at nail chips or tears. getting your finger crushed in a door.
